PPG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2021 in Review

992 of the 5,695 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in PPG Industries (PPG) for Q1 2021, worth a combined $29.1B — up 4.7% from $27.8B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 82 funds opened new PPG positions and 75 closed out — a net gain of 7 holders — while 326 added to existing stakes and 366 trimmed.

The largest buyer was JP Morgan Chase, adding an estimated $669M. The largest seller was Wells Fargo, cutting an estimated $191M.
